Inicio>Cuadros Entelados>A closeup of the electronic components embedded within a smart drug delivery patch showcasing the microcontroller and sensors that monitor the bodys responses paired with a visual representation
A closeup of the electronic components embedded within a smart drug delivery patch showcasing the microcontroller and sensors that monitor the bodys responses paired with a visual representation #1244157737